Implementation notes: amd64, nalla, crypto_stream/trivium

Computer: nalla
Architecture: amd64
CPU ID: GenuineIntel-000006fb-bfebfbff
SUPERCOP version: 20100728
Operation: crypto_stream
Primitive: trivium
TimeImplementationCompilerBenchmark dateSUPERCOP version
6132e/submissions/triviumgcc -funroll-loops -m64 -Os -fomit-frame-pointer2010080420100728
6174e/submissions/triviumgcc -funroll-loops -Os -fomit-frame-pointer2010080420100728
6174e/submissions/triviumgc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er2010080420100728
6174e/submissions/triviumgcc -funroll-loops -march=k8 -Os -fomit-frame-pointer2010080420100728
6180e/submissions/triviumgc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er2010080420100728
6210e/submissions/triviumgcc -funroll-loops -O3 -fomit-frame-pointer2010080420100728
6210e/submissions/triviumgcc -funroll-loops -m64 -O3 -fomit-frame-pointer2010080420100728
6210e/submissions/triviumgc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er2010080420100728
6216e/submissions/triviumgc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er2010080420100728
6252e/submissions/triviumgcc -funroll-loops -O2 -fomit-frame-pointer2010080420100728
6252e/submissions/triviumgc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er2010080420100728
6258e/submissions/triviumgc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er2010080420100728
6258e/submissions/triviumgcc -funroll-loops -march=nocona -Os -fomit-frame-pointer2010080420100728
6282e/submissions/triviumgc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er2010080420100728
6282e/submissions/triviumgc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er2010080420100728
6288e/submissions/triviumgc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er2010080420100728
6288e/submissions/triviumgcc -funroll-loops -m64 -O2 -fomit-frame-pointer2010080420100728
6342e/submissions/triviumgcc -Os -fomit-frame-pointer2010080420100728
6342e/submissions/triviumgcc -march=k8 -Os -fomit-frame-pointer2010080420100728
6348e/submissions/triviumgcc -fno-schedule-insns -Os -fomit-frame-pointer2010080420100728
6354e/submissions/triviumgcc -m64 -Os -fomit-frame-pointer2010080420100728
6354e/submissions/triviumgcc -m64 -march=k8 -Os -fomit-frame-pointer2010080420100728
6408e/submissions/triviumgcc -m64 -march=core2 -Os -fomit-frame-pointer2010080420100728
6408e/submissions/triviumgcc -march=nocona -Os -fomit-frame-pointer2010080420100728
6414e/submissions/triviumgcc -m64 -march=nocona -Os -fomit-frame-pointer2010080420100728
6492e/submissions/triviumgcc -funroll-loops -O -fomit-frame-pointer2010080420100728
6492e/submissions/triviumgc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er2010080420100728
6492e/submissions/triviumgcc -funroll-loops -m64 -O -fomit-frame-pointer2010080420100728
6492e/submissions/triviumgc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er2010080420100728
6492e/submissions/triviumgcc -funroll-loops -march=k8 -O -fomit-frame-pointer2010080420100728
6498e/submissions/triviumgc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er2010080420100728
6522e/submissions/triviumgcc -funroll-loops -march=nocona -O -fomit-frame-pointer2010080420100728
6558e/submissions/triviumgc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er2010080420100728
6558e/submissions/triviumgc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er2010080420100728
6564e/submissions/triviumgc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er2010080420100728
6642e/submissions/triviumgcc -m64 -O3 -fomit-frame-pointer2010080420100728
6648e/submissions/triviumgcc -fno-schedule-insns -O2 -fomit-frame-pointer2010080420100728
6654e/submissions/triviumgcc -m64 -O2 -fomit-frame-pointer2010080420100728
6660e/submissions/triviumgcc -fno-schedule-insns -O3 -fomit-frame-pointer2010080420100728
6666e/submissions/triviumgcc -march=nocona -O2 -fomit-frame-pointer2010080420100728
6672e/submissions/triviumgcc -m64 -march=nocona -O2 -fomit-frame-pointer2010080420100728
6678e/submissions/triviumgcc -march=nocona -O3 -fomit-frame-pointer2010080420100728
6690e/submissions/triviumgcc -O2 -fomit-frame-pointer2010080420100728
6690e/submissions/triviumgcc -m64 -march=k8 -O3 -fomit-frame-pointer2010080420100728
6690e/submissions/triviumgcc -m64 -march=nocona -O3 -fomit-frame-pointer2010080420100728
6702e/submissions/triviumgcc -O3 -fomit-frame-pointer2010080420100728
6702e/submissions/triviumgcc -march=k8 -O3 -fomit-frame-pointer2010080420100728
6720e/submissions/triviumgc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er2010080420100728
6720e/submissions/triviumgcc -march=k8 -O2 -fomit-frame-pointer2010080420100728
6732e/submissions/triviumgcc -m64 -march=k8 -O2 -fomit-frame-pointer2010080420100728
6738e/submissions/triviumgcc -m64 -march=core2 -O2 -fomit-frame-pointer2010080420100728
6750e/submissions/triviumgcc -m64 -march=core2 -O3 -fomit-frame-pointer2010080420100728
6804e/submissions/triviumgcc -O -fomit-frame-pointer2010080420100728
6816e/submissions/triviumgcc -fno-schedule-insns -O -fomit-frame-pointer2010080420100728
6816e/submissions/triviumgcc -m64 -O -fomit-frame-pointer2010080420100728
6816e/submissions/triviumgcc -m64 -march=core2 -O -fomit-frame-pointer2010080420100728
6822e/submissions/triviumgcc -march=k8 -O -fomit-frame-pointer2010080420100728
6834e/submissions/triviumgcc -m64 -march=nocona -O -fomit-frame-pointer2010080420100728
6834e/submissions/triviumgcc -march=nocona -O -fomit-frame-pointer2010080420100728
6846e/submissions/triviumgcc -m64 -march=k8 -O -fomit-frame-pointer2010080420100728
12264e/submissions/triviumgcc -funroll-loops2010080420100728
12288e/submissions/triviumcc2010080420100728
12288e/submissions/triviumgcc2010080420100728